  4. Task Scheduler task files need conversion to XML

    Corrupt task scheduler

    The same way as you restore your own tasks:

    1. Copy the underlying .xml file to some holding areaa, e.g.

      c:\Windows\System32\Tasks\Microsoft\Windows\WDI\ResolutionHost -> C:\Tasks
    2. Rename the copied task file by adding an .xml extension.
    3. Open the Task Scheduler and navigate to the relevant subfolder.
    4. Import the renamed file.
    It is unlikely that you need to recreate system tasks. They are in most cases intact.
